首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>WSO2 Api管理可伸缩性

WSO2 Api管理可伸缩性
EN

Stack Overflow用户
提问于 2016-01-03 20:19:25
回答 2查看 714关注 0票数 0

有谁有关于WSO2 2的API管理产品的可伸缩性的数据吗?

每秒并发用户/API调用的数量、正在传输的数据以及如何在部署模型方面实现可伸缩性。

谢谢,

格雷格

EN

回答 2

Stack Overflow用户

回答已采纳

发布于 2016-01-08 08:01:46

根据我们实验室的基准测试,网关节点在一个2网关节点集群中以150并发方式运行时,每秒可以处理~3000事务。请查找设置和性能测试的详细信息。

  • 并发: 150
  • TPS: 3000
  • 回应时间: 30

基本设置细节

WSO2 API管理器:网关-2-活动/活动

WSO2 API管理器:密钥管理器-2-活动/活动

WSO2 API管理器: Publisher -1-主动/被动

WSO2 API管理器:存储-1-主动/被动

缓存设置

启用网关缓存

硬件设置

物理:3 3GHz双核Xeon/Opteron (或最新版本),4 GB RAM ( JVM至少2 GB,操作系统2GB,基于预期存储需求的10 GB空闲磁盘空间(最小)磁盘(通过考虑文件上传和备份策略计算)。(例如,如果在一台机器上运行3个碳实例,它需要4 CPU,8 GB RAM,30 GB空闲空间)

虚拟机:最少有2个计算单元(每个单元有1.2-1.2 GHz Opteron/Xeon处理器),4 GB RAM,10 GB空闲磁盘空间。一个cpu单元用于操作系统,另一个用于JVM。(例如,如果运行3个碳实例需要4台计算单元的VM,8 GB RAM,30 GB空闲空间)

EC2 :c3.大型实例,用于运行一个碳实例。注意:基于c3.large实例的I/O性能,建议在更大的实例(c3.xlarge或c3.2xlarge)中运行多个实例。

根据这些结果,一个节点最多可以处理3000 TPS。此TPS值可以随时间内并发级别和负载的不同而变化。因此,当缩放时,我们假设每个节点可以处理多达3000个TPS,从而增加整个TPS。

票数 1
EN

Stack Overflow用户

发布于 2016-01-04 09:56:46

WSO2 API Manger有节流层策略,允许您在给定的time.for示例期间限制对API的成功点击次数。

  1. 青铜:每分钟1次请求
  2. Silver:每分钟5次请求
  3. Gold:每分钟20次请求
  4. 无限:无限制访问。

有关节流策略12的详细信息,请参阅以下链接。

票数 -2
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/34581149

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档